Meunier's Eagle Project Becomes a Labyrinth of Love
Parsippany teen spearheads effort to clean up area near Knoll Country Club parking lot.
Whiz Kid’s Name: Stéphane Meunier
Whiz Kid’s Age: 16 years old
Whiz Kid’s School: Parsippany Hills High School

Whiz Kid’s Key to Awesomeness: Completed Eagle Scout Leadership Service Project
For Boy Scout Stéphane Meunier, a member of Troop 39 in Morris Plains, the completion of his Eagle Scout Leadership Service Project was not only an opportunity to demonstrate his leadership abilities and the skills he has acquired during his years as a Scout. It was a chance to benefit the members of his Parsippany community.

Meunier was introduced to Bobbie Humphrey, a woman who created a medication labyrinth in an unused parking lot at the Knoll Country Club. The meditation labyrinth is supposed to help relax the mind, however, the area was not in the best condition.
Meunier decided he needed to improve the lot's appearance so that it could offer a soothing experience for those who visit. Together with Humphrey, he decided to landscape and plant flowers around the fence and hillside and created signage to direct visitors to the labyrinth.
On a recent weekend in May, Meunier successfully completed the project making just a few minor adjustments to the plants he had planned so they would not fall prey to local wildlife.
“I was most proud about getting the 40 volunteers consisting of friends, family and scouts from my troop and other local troops to come out and help transform this area,” he said.
For Meunier, creating a relaxing place for the community to share was well worth the effort.
“It’s a lot of work to reach this point but there is a sense of accomplishment and that is a great feeling.”
